The Cost Side: Actual Numbers, Not Hype
Construction job efficiency resides in the margins. No solitary method drops a spending plan by 20 percent, but a dozen choices at 1 to 3 percent each do. Neighborhood provider partnerships help expenses in a few means:
- Short lead times decrease lug expenses. Every week a project runs long includes interest if you are financing, and includes lease or short-lived real estate expenses if you are living in other places throughout a renovation. Fewer change orders from replacement materials. When an item takes place backorder, substituting usually calls for re-engineering or different setup techniques. That creates labor creep. Reduced waste. Suppliers who know your superintendent will certainly right-size shipments. They will stage drop-offs so materials are not cooking in the sunlight or swelling in the rainfall, which diminishes damages and theft.
I have seen typical household additions in Groton, say 350 to 600 square feet, save 1 to 2 weeks over the timeline compared with out-of-town service providers who do not have those partnerships. If your daily melt rate on a task with five trades on-site is 2,000 to 3,000 dollars consisting of labor and overhead, shaving also five days can preserve 10,000 to 15,000 bucks. Those are actual bucks that rarely appear on the preliminary quote sheet.
Case Pictures From the Field
A cooking area restoration in a 1920s cottage near Eastern Point hit a snag when the specified 36-inch array hood with personalized lining was delayed 3 weeks. The regional provider flagged the delay proactively and offered two in-stock alternatives, one from a brand name they knew executed well in seaside environments. The contractor got the revised specification to the building department with a fast cut sheet showing similar CFM and make-up air requirements. Assessment remained on schedule. Without that chain of interaction, the drywall stage would have stalled, postponing cupboard set up, electric trim, and kitchen counters. That single pivot stayed clear of a cause and effect that can have included ten days.
On a deck rebuild off Coast Road, the preliminary layout called for a composite that often tends to warm up under straight southern exposure. The neighborhood yard suggested a different line with a lighter capstock and offered a sample that sat on the client's existing deck for a week. That small adjustment kept the client happy, and the distributor supplied two additional joists within hours when the field conditions required extra obstructing at the stairways. Quick delivery implied the team equaled the evaluation home window and the client enjoyed the deck before peak summer.

Winter, Salt, and Timing Windows
Groton's closeness to the water keeps air damp. Outside paint timetables have to appreciate humidity, not simply daytime highs. An experienced local basic professional in Groton, CT budgets for coatings that treat in those problems and chooses crews that keep an eye on dampness content in trim and exterior siding before painting. The same logic applies to concrete. A January put near the Thames River requires coverings and a cautious eye on overnight lows. Neighborhood suppliers can get calcium chloride or protecting coverings to the site within hours when the projection shifts.
Timing also matters for coastline residential properties regulated by seaside policies. A locally possessed building and construction company accustomed to the Coastal Location Administration evaluation procedure can sequence website job to keep erosion controls intact and examinations smooth. That understanding keeps you from opening up ground at the incorrect time and triggering a compliance frustration that stalls everything.
Value Design That Does Not Lower the Build
Cutting cost without reducing edges is an art. The most effective worth design occurs early, when requirements selections are still fluid. A relied on contractor Groton citizens employ repeatedly will sit with you and the developer to target things that are long-lead or cost-heavy without driving the layout off the rails. Exchanging a specialized home window setup for a standard dimension the local backyard supplies can remove 6 weeks of waiting and thousands in customized fees. Changing from a personalized steel pan to a tiled shower with a pre-sloped foam base can cut a day of labor and keep waterproofing trustworthy in an older home.
The technique is understanding where area problems will certainly battle you. In Groton's older housing supply, walls are seldom square. Cupboards that count on incredibly tight tolerances can come to be time sinks. A contractor who has actually leveled a hundred jagged kitchens will certainly define scribe filler panels and plywood build-outs to maintain set up time predictable and the final appearance crisp.

Practical Examples of Neighborhood Leverage
Consider a Groton CT home renovation project to end up a walkout cellar. The layout consists of a moving door available to a little patio area. In spring, the groundwater level increases. A neighborhood contractor will certainly core-sample and examine water drainage prior to devoting to a below-grade slab altitude. They will certainly add an interior ground drain linked to a pump with a check valve ranked for briny air, then spec a door threshold that tolerates periodic dash. The neighborhood yard delivers the proper blinking package and a composite trim that will certainly not wick wetness. Licenses consist of a clear egress plan and a letter on mechanical air flow from the HVAC subcontractor. Examiners see a strategy grounded in neighborhood reality, not a common basement from inland Connecticut. Approval and assessments move smoothly.
Or take a small industrial renter fit-out near the Submarine Base. Gain access to for shipments can be tight because of safety and security and traffic. A local general contractor timetables high-noise work outside of base shift modifications and works with deliveries with roads that avoid traffic jams. Vendors go down products early, labeled for quick inventory, due to the fact that they rely on the site will prepare. A straightforward selection like staging drywall far from exterior doors lowers humidity spikes that trigger tape problems later on. The task opens in a timely manner, and the owner starts gathering rent.
